Transaction ec2f6420829a04154e04fa16f923f2994671aade2f27b67cbaacfc32068ec908

1 Input
2 Outputs
  • ec2f6420829a04154e04fa16f923f2994671aade2f27b67cbaacfc32068ec908:0
  • value  412044
    address  1CDodydcuntj3brHGvYcEPFnqKjFYu2St9
  • ec2f6420829a04154e04fa16f923f2994671aade2f27b67cbaacfc32068ec908:1
  • value  13170495
    address  3PUTzrEbnoKK4oMzTgsM2W4somAqMTEopW